from Google AI:
A SLAPP (Strategic Lawsuit Against Public Participation) lawsuit is a legal action intended to silence critics by burdening them with the cost and stress of a legal defense, rather than a genuine claim. These lawsuits are often filed by powerful individuals or entities against those who are speaking out on public issues, such as environmental concerns, human rights, or government corruption.
